Help! I think my frog is sick! And I'm a new frog mommy!

The first day he sat at the top of the tank with his bottom still in the water. He has now propped himself out of the water and keeps sitting up there. I have two African dwarf frogs and the second one isn't acting like the first. I read online and it doesn't seem to be normal behaviour please help ? He is in a huge tank with at least 10 other fish.

How deep is the tank? They aren't the best swimmers but they do need air (kind of a bad design for a completely aquatic creature), so it might just be that the tank is too deep for it to comfortably swim up to the surface.

if your frog spends a lot of time out of the water, it could mean your water isn't being properly oxygenated. check your parameters and make sure everything is balanced. otherwise, he could just be asking for a place near the surface to hang out. just make sure it isn't too close to the surface or he could try to jump out!
